Transaction 963c19c9925229faa5aa435831bcdf881c8e7ec851959291c623ce001aa08d84
1 Input
1 Output
-
963c19c9925229faa5aa435831bcdf881c8e7ec851959291c623ce001aa08d84:0
- value
- 4506511
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1bf43728120925bf9487643a6ffc16bdec8036bc OP_EQUAL
- address
- 34Epj7MtyKfcmmHUC1GfhNCDUDi4p24KSp